C68300 Brass vs. C22600 Bronze

Both C68300 brass and C22600 bronze are copper alloys. They have 73% of their average alloy composition in common. There are 28 material properties with values for both materials. Properties with values for just one material (3, in this case) are not shown.

For each property being compared, the top bar is C68300 brass and the bottom bar is C22600 bronze.
